The compressible behaviors of the selected 5d transition metal carbides MC (M=W,Re,Os,Ir) with hexagonal tungsten carbide-type structure were studied by first-principles calculations. Results indicate that the incompressibility of ReC exceeds that of diamond under higher pressure. The calculated method for hardness of crystals with partial metallic bonding is suggested and the calculated results indicate that hexagonal ReC crystal possesses excellent mechanical properties.
